We have a rewarding opportunity available on our Renal/Metabolic Care C5 unit at Methodist Hospital! This 26-bed unit provides 24-hour care to acutely ill patients. This unit is a medical unit that cares for patients with a variety of medical diagnosis which could include renal disease, diabetes management, wound management, pain management, and vascular access issues supporting patients varying from young adult to the geriatric age group. This unit is the designated unit for providing all Continuous Ambulatory Peritoneal Dialysis (CAPD) for Methodist Hospital.

This unit also embodies an additional unit, B5, a 5-bed End of Life Care unit that is dedicated to the care of patients at the end of life, including both palliative and hospice care.

The Patient Care Intern Progression Program helps student nurses on their pathway to becoming an RN while gaining hands-on patient care experience. IU Health provides these future nurses with learning, mentorship, and progression opportunities as they work toward their degree. In this role, you'll work alongside other healthcare professionals to strengthen your skills in patient care, decision-making, and critical thinking.

The Patient Care Intern I (PCI I) works under the direction of the registered nurse (RN) as a non-licensed team member. As a non-licensed team member, the PCI provides care to designated patients and supports the patient care team. Job duties include observation of the registered nurse, provision of activities of daily living, mobility assistance, mobility assistance, continuous observation including suicide prevention, and ensuring the patient's surroundings are clean and orderly.
